- Get link
- X
- Other Apps
- Get link
- X
- Other Apps
Azure DevOps: Configuring Azure Credentials: A Vital Step in Cloud Management
Azure
is Microsoft's cloud computing platform, offering a wide range of services, including
virtual machines, databases, and AI, enabling businesses to build, deploy, and
manage applications and services in the cloud. -Azure DevOps Training Online
In the ever-evolving landscape of cloud
computing, Microsoft Azure has emerged as a dominant player, providing a wide
range of services for businesses and developers. To harness the power of Azure
effectively, configuring Azure credentials is a critical step in securing and
managing your resources. This article explores the significance of Azure
credentials configuration and offers insights into best practices. -Azure DevOps Training
Azure
Credentials: What Are They?
Azure credentials are authentication and
authorization tokens that allow users, applications, or services to access and
interact with Azure resources. These credentials ensure that only authorized
entities can manipulate Azure resources, guaranteeing security and compliance.
Types of Azure Credentials:
Azure Active Directory (Azure AD): Azure AD
credentials are commonly used for user authentication. They can be in the form
of usernames and passwords, or more secure methods like multi-factor
authentication.
Service Principal: Service principals are
non-human identities that represent applications, services, or automation
tasks. They are essential for automation, as they grant permissions to perform
tasks on your behalf. -Microsoft Azure DevOps Online Training
Managed
Identity: Managed identities are a secure way
for Azure services and resources to authenticate themselves within the Azure
environment. They eliminate the need for storing credentials in code.
Shared
Access Signature (SAS) Token:
SAS tokens grant time-limited access to specific Azure resources, making them
ideal for temporary access or sharing resources with external parties.
Best Practices for Azure Credentials Configuration:
Use Managed
Identities: Whenever
possible, opt for managed identities to avoid handling secrets directly. This
improves security and reduces the risk of credential exposure. -Azure DevOps Training in Ameerpet
Role-Based
Access Control (RBAC): Implement
RBAC to assign appropriate permissions to users, services, and applications.
Follow the principle of least privilege to limit access to only what is
necessary.
Regularly
Rotate Credentials: For credentials
like SAS tokens or service principals, implement a rotation policy to enhance
security.
Monitor and
Audit: Set up monitoring and auditing to
track activities and detect suspicious behavior. Azure provides tools and
services for this purpose.
Use Key
Vault: Store and manage secrets securely in
Azure Key Vault, reducing the risk of accidental exposure. -Azure DevOps Course Online
In conclusion, Azure credentials configuration
is a foundational aspect of managing your Azure resources. Whether for
security, compliance, or efficient resource management, understanding the
different types of credentials and following best practices is crucial for a
successful Azure deployment. By implementing proper configuration, you can
harness the full potential of Azure while safeguarding your assets and data.
Visualpath is the Best Software Online Training
Institute in Ameerpet, Hyderabad. Avail complete Azure
DevOps Online Training by
simply enrolling in our institute, Hyderabad. You will get the best course at
an affordable cost.
Attend Free Demo
Call on - +91-9989971070.
Visit https://visualpath.in/Microsoft-Azure-DevOps-online-Training.html
AzureDevOpsCourseOnline
AzureDevOpsOnlineTraining
AzureDevOpsOnlineTraininginHyderabad
AzureDevOpsTraininginHyderabad
AzureDevOpsTrainingOnline
MicrosoftAzureDevOpsOnlineTraining
- Get link
- X
- Other Apps
Comments
Post a Comment